SOOTHING BATH TREATMENT FOR ECZEMA AND DRY SKIN CONDITIONS Fragrance free REHYDRATES AND PROTECTS SUITABLE FOR BABIES AND CHILDREN light liquid paraffin BATH ADDITIVE JUNIOR MARKETING AUTHORISATION HOLDER: Thornton & Ross Ltd., Linthwaite, Huddersfield, HD7 5QH, UK. MANUFACTURER: Delpharm Bladel B.V., Industrieweg 1, 5331 AD Bladel, The Netherlands. PL 00240/0464 Date of information: June 2020. 150 ML DIRECTIONS ALWAYS USE WITH WATER. BATH: Add 1-3 capfuls to an 8 inch bath of water. Soak for 10-20 minutes, pat dry. INFANT BATH: Add ½ to 2 capfuls to a small bath of water. Apply gently over the entire body with a sponge. Pat dry. SKIN CLEANSING: Rub a small amount into wet skin, rinse off and pat dry. WARNINGS Take care against slipping in the bath. Avoid contact with eyes. Do not use if allergic to any of the ingredients listed. Do not smoke or go near naked flames - risk of severe burns. Fabric (clothing, bedding, dressings etc) that has been in contact with this product burns more easily and is a serious fire hazard. Washing clothing and bedding may reduce product build-up but not totally remove it. Reporting of side effects If you get any side effects e.g. rash, skin irritation, talk to your doctor, pharmacist or nurse. This includes any possible side effects not listed on this carton. You can also report side effects directly via the Yellow Card Scheme at: www.mhra.gov.uk/yellowcard. By reporting side effects you can help provide more information on the safety of this medicine. USE THIS MEDICINE ONLY ON YOUR SKIN. KEEP OUT OF THE SIGHT AND REACH OF CHILDREN. ACTIVE INGREDIENTS light liquid paraffin 63.4% w/w OTHER INGREDIENTS: Acetylated Lanolin Alcohols, Isopropyl Palmitate, Polyethylene Glycol 400 Dilaurate, Macrogol Ester. Name of the medicinal product Oilatum Junior Oilatum Emollient Fragrance Free 2. Qualitative and quantitative composition Light Liquid paraffin BP 63.4% w/w. 3. Pharmaceutical form Liquid bath additive. 4. Clinical particulars 4.1 Therapeutic indications Oilatum Junior is indicated in the treatment of contact dermatitis, atopic dermatitis, senile pruritus, ichthyosis and related dry skin conditions. Route of administration: Topical 4.2 Posology and method of administration Oilatum Junior may be used as frequently as necessary. Oilatum Junior should always be used with water, either added to the water or applied to wet skin. For adults add 1-3 capfuls to an 8 inch bath of water. Soak for 10-20 minutes. Pat dry.
